3.2 IF Connections

There may be DC voltages present on the Type ‘N’ Rx and Tx IF
connectors, up to a maximum of 48 volts.


CDM-570L:
The IF port connectors are both 50

Ω ‘N’ female types. The return loss on these

ports is greater than 19 dB (typically better than 21 dB). If there is a need to connect to a 75

Ω

system, an inexpensive ‘N’ to ‘F’ type adapter can be used. While there will be a reduction in
return loss when doing this, the effect in most systems will be imperceptible.

CDM-570: The IF port connectors are both BNC female types. The return loss on these ports is
greater than 17 dB (typically better than 19 dB) in BOTH 50

Ω and 75Ω systems.

3.2.1 Rx IF Connectors

Connector Type

Description

Direction

CDM-570L: Type ‘N’
(Shown at left)

Rx IF signal, L- band

In

CDM-570: BNC
(Shown at right)

Rx IF signal, 70/140 MHz band

 
 
 
 

3.2.2 Tx IF Connectors

Connector Type

Description

Direction

CDM-570L: Type ‘N’
(Shown at left)

Tx IF signal, L- band

Out

CDM-570: BNC
(Shown at right)

Tx IF signal, 70/140 MHz band
